Introduction

I offer person-centered therapy grounded in compassion, insight, and the belief that we all carry the capacity to heal and grow. My clients are navigating transitions—menopause, parenting shifts, career changes, coming out, or questioning long held beliefs. Many are educators facing burnout or emotional fatigue. These shifts often stir anxiety or a sense of being stuck, even when life looks “fine” on the outside. My clients aren’t necessarily in crisis—they’re curious, reflective, and ready to reclaim parts of themselves that have been quiet for too long. With 28 years in education, I bring deep insight into the realities of school systems. My practice is built for educators—teachers, counselors, administrators, and paraeducators—who are burned out, overwhelmed, or simply craving a space to breathe. You won’t need to explain the acronyms or justify your your exhaustion. I’ve walked those halls. I offer an integrative approach that blends emotional insight, values exploration, and practical tools.
